SUMMARY:PhD Defense by Lorenzo Paoloni: "On the Moduli Space Curvature and Gravity Decoupling"
DESCRIPTION:Title: On the Moduli Space Curvature and Gravity Decoupling\n\nVenue & Time: Blue Room / 10:00-12:30\n\nAbstract: This thesis investigates the asymptotic regimes of four-dimensional N = 2 supergravity moduli spaces\, seeking a robust geometric definition of gravity decoupling. It does so in the context of the Swampland Program\, whose primary objective is to delineate the precise boundaries between consistent low-energy effective field theories and those incompatible with quantum gravity. Ultimately\, this thesis establishes a precise\, quantifiable dictionary between macroscopic moduli space geometry and microscopic quantum field theory constraints\, demonstrating that scalar curvature divergences at infinite distance are not geometric artifacts\, but rather the definitive sentinels of quantum field theories successfully isolating themselves from gravity.\n\n\n\n\nSupervisor: Fernando Marchesano
